Find out which TV shows and movies were the most watched on Netflix UK last week.

Every week Netflix publishes weekly data on its most-watched programming in all of the territories it operates in around the world.

Here are the most-watched TV shows and films by Netflix viewers in the UK for last week, Monday, August 8 to Sunday, August 14.


Netflix UK top 10 TV shows:

1. (1) The Sandman, season 1
2. (-) Never Have I Ever, season 3
3. (2) Stranger Things 4
4. (-) I Just Killed My Dad, season 1
5. (-) Locke & Key, season 3
6. (4) Virgin River, season 4
7. (5) Trainwreck: Woodstock '99, season 1
8. (8) Better Call Saul, season 6
9. (3) Keep Breathing
10. (9) Stranger Things 3


Netflix UK top 10 movies:

1. (-) Day Shift
2. (1) Purple Hearts
3. (2) The Gray Man
4. (-) The Wedding Date
5. (6) Wedding Season
6. (9) Carter
7. (3) Rogue Agent
8. (8) The Sea Beast
9. (5) The Hitman's Wife's Bodyguard
10. (-) Darlings
